Comprehensive Termite Inspections

The first critical step in any effective termite management plan is a thorough inspection. Our certified termite specialists conduct detailed examinations of your property, both interior and exterior, to accurately identify the presence of termites, assess the extent of any damage, and pinpoint potential entry points and conducive conditions.

Visual and Specialized Assessment

Our initial assessment begins with a meticulous visual inspection. Technicians meticulously examine accessible areas of your home or business, including basements, crawl spaces, attics, foundations, and exterior perimeter. We look for classic signs such as mud tubes, discarded wings, wood damage, and efflorescence. For more challenging areas, we may employ specialized tools like moisture meters, infrared cameras, or even boroscopes to detect hidden termite activity behind walls or within wooden structures. This comprehensive approach ensures that no stone is left unturned in identifying the full scope of the infestation.

Diagnosis of Termite Species

Not all termites are created equal. Different species, such as subterranean termites, drywood termites, and dampwood termites, exhibit distinct behaviors and require varied treatment protocols. Our experts are adept at identifying the specific species infesting your property, which is crucial for determining the most effective and targeted treatment strategy. Understanding the biology and habits of the specific termite species allows us to tailor our approach for maximum efficacy and lasting results.

Advanced Termite Treatment Solutions

Once the inspection is complete and the termite species identified, we develop a customized treatment plan utilizing the most advanced and environmentally responsible methods available. Our goal is complete eradication and long-term prevention.

Subterranean Termite Control

Subterranean termites are the most destructive species, forming vast underground colonies. Our treatment for these termites typically involves liquid barrier treatments and baiting systems.

  • Liquid Termiticide Barriers: We create a protective barrier around your home’s foundation using state-of-the-art termiticides. These non-repellent products are undetectable to termites, allowing them to unknowingly carry the active ingredient back to their colony, leading to widespread elimination. Our application techniques are precise, ensuring effective coverage without excessive chemical usage.
  • Termite Baiting Systems: For an alternative or supplementary approach, we install strategically placed bait stations around your property. Termites feed on the bait, which contains slow-acting insect growth regulators, carrying it back to the colony and disrupting their growth cycle. This method offers a highly effective, low-impact solution, particularly for properties where liquid treatments may be challenging or undesirable.

Drywood Termite Extermination

Drywood termites infest dry, sound wood directly, without needing soil contact. Treatment approaches often include localized spot treatments, fumigation for severe infestations, and wood treatments.

  • Localized Treatments: For smaller, isolated drywood termite infestations, we can conduct localized treatments using termiticides injected directly into infested wood, or microwave/heat treatments. This targets specific areas of activity, minimizing disruption to your property.
  • Fumigation (Tent Fumigation): For widespread or inaccessible drywood termite infestations, we may recommend structural fumigation. This involves enclosing the entire structure in a tent and introducing a gaseous fumigant that penetrates all wood, eliminating termites wherever they hide. While requiring temporary evacuation, it is the most effective method for complete drywood termite eradication in severe cases.
  • Wood Preservation Solutions: We can also apply borate treatments to susceptible wood structures. These treatments penetrate the wood, making it unpalatable and toxic to termites, providing long-lasting protection against future infestations.

Ongoing Monitoring and Prevention

Our service doesn’t end with treatment. We believe in proactive monitoring and establishing preventative measures to ensure your property remains termite-free for years to come.

Post-Treatment Follow-Up

After treatment, we schedule follow-up visits to monitor activity, assess the effectiveness of the treatment, and make any necessary adjustments. This ongoing vigilance is crucial for confirming complete eradication and preventing re-infestation. We document our findings and provide you with comprehensive reports.

Preventative Strategies and Maintenance Tips

Education is a key component of our prevention strategy. Our technicians will provide you with valuable advice and practical tips on how to make your property less inviting to termites. This includes recommendations on improving drainage, reducing wood-to-soil contact, sealing cracks in foundations, and managing moisture levels. By addressing these conducive conditions, you can significantly reduce the risk of future termite problems. We can also set up annual inspection plans to catch any new activity early.

Termites: The Silent Destroyers

Termites are infamous for their ability to cause extensive structural damage without immediate detection. Subterranean termites, the most common type in California, live in underground colonies and build mud tubes to travel from the soil to your home’s wooden structures. Drywood termites, on the other hand, infest dry wood directly, often leaving behind small, pellet-like droppings known as frass. The damage they inflict can compromise the integrity of wooden beams, floors, and walls, leading to expensive repairs if left unchecked. Early detection and professional intervention are vital to prevent long-term damage and maintain your property’s value. Signs include buckling floors, sagging ceilings, swollen door frames, and faint clicking sounds coming from walls.

Even though termites are small, their colonies can number in the millions, and their relentless chewing can go unnoticed for years. They consume cellulose-based materials, which means not just wood, but also books, insulation, and even swimming pool liners are at risk. Prevention is often better than a cure when it comes to these persistent pests. Ants: Ubiquitous Invaders

Ants, particularly Argentine ants and odorous house ants, are a constant nuisance in Glendale. They enter homes through tiny cracks and crevices in search of food, water, and shelter, often forming long trails as they forage. While generally not harmful to structures, they can contaminate food, become a significant annoyance, and some species like carpenter ants can even tunnel into wood, although they don’t consume it like termites do. Identifying ant trails, seeing ants in kitchens or bathrooms, or finding small piles of wood shavings (for carpenter ants) are clear indicators of an infestation.

Managing an ant problem requires more than just spraying visible ants. It involves identifying colony locations, eliminating food sources, sealing entry points, and applying professional-grade baits and sprays designed to target the entire colony. Cockroaches: Unsanitary Pests

Cockroaches are resilient, reproduce rapidly, and pose significant health risks, acting as vectors for bacteria and allergens. German cockroaches are particularly problematic in homes and restaurants, while American cockroaches are often found in sewers and basements. Evidence of cockroaches includes their droppings (which resemble coffee grounds or black pepper), egg casings, a musty odor, and of course, seeing live cockroaches, especially at night. Their presence indicates unsanitary conditions, though they can infest even clean homes by hitchhiking in.

Effective cockroach control requires a multifaceted approach, including sanitation improvements, sealing entry points, and professional application of baits, insect growth regulators, and residual sprays. Rodents: Property Damage and Health Risks

Mice and rats are not just a nuisance; they can cause significant property damage by gnawing on electrical wires, pipes, and structural elements, posing fire hazards and plumbing issues. They also carry numerous diseases and can contaminate food and surfaces with their urine and feces. Signs of rodent activity include gnaw marks, droppings, urine stains, scratching noises in walls or attics, and visible sightings. Their rapid reproduction rates mean a small problem can quickly escalate into a full-blown infestation.

Bed Bugs: Persistent Blood-Feeders

Bed bugs are notoriously difficult to eliminate without professional help. These tiny, nocturnal pests feed on human blood, causing itchy bites, typically in lines or clusters. They hide in cracks and crevices during the day, commonly in mattresses, bed frames, furniture, and even electrical outlets. Signs include reddish-brown spots on bedding (feces), shed skins, and actual sightings of the bugs themselves. Infestations often originate from travel, used furniture, or adjacent infested units in multi-family dwellings.

Signs You Need Professional Pest Control

Many homeowners try DIY solutions for pest problems, but these often only provide temporary relief. For effective and long-lasting solutions, professional pest control is almost always necessary. Here are common indicators that it’s time to call the experts:

Visible Pests

The most obvious sign is seeing live pests. Whether it’s a few ants in the kitchen, a spider crawling across the wall, or a mouse darting across the floor, even a single sighting can indicate a larger, hidden population. Nocturnal pests like cockroaches or rodents emerging during the day often suggest a significant infestation and overcrowding in their harborage areas.

Droppings or Urine Stains

Pest droppings are a definitive sign of activity. Rodent droppings resemble small, dark pellets, while cockroach droppings look like coffee grounds or black pepper. Termite frass (drywood termite droppings) are tiny, hexagonal pellets. Urine stains from rodents also have a distinct, strong odor. Discovering these signs in pantries, behind appliances, or in attics confirms pest presence.

Gnaw Marks or Damage

Rodents are notorious for gnawing on various materials to wear down their continuously growing teeth. Look for chew marks on food packaging, electrical wires, wooden furniture, plastic pipes, or even structural elements. Termites, on the other hand, consume wood, leading to hollow-sounding timber, buckling floors, or blistered paint on walls.

Unusual Smells

Many pests leave distinctive odors. Cockroaches can produce a musty, oily smell. Rodents often leave a stale, ammonia-like odor from their urine, especially in confined spaces like attics or basements. A sweet, strong smell can sometimes indicate a large ant infestation. These unusual smells, especially if persistent, point to pest activity.

Nesting Materials

Rodents, in particular, will gather soft materials like shredded paper, fabric, insulation, or dried plant matter to build their nests in secluded areas such as attics, crawl spaces, wall voids, or behind appliances. Finding these unexpected caches of material indicates active nesting and reproduction.

Mud Tubes or Discarded Wings

These are classic signs of termites. Subterranean termites construct pencil-sized mud tubes on foundations, walls, or wooden beams as protected pathways between their underground colonies and your home’s wood. For swarmers (reproductive termites), finding discarded wings near windowsills or light sources, particularly in spring or fall, indicates a nearby mature colony.

Itchy Bites or Rashes

If you’re waking up with unexplained itchy bites, especially in lines or clusters, bed bugs are a strong suspect. Mosquitoes and fleas can also cause irritating bites. Consistent itching or the appearance of rashes without other clear causes warrant an investigation for biting insects.

Structural Damage

While often a later sign, structural damage is a critical indicator, especially for termites. This can manifest as sagging floors, ceilings, or walls, doors and windows that stick, or small holes in drywall. Such damage signifies a significant and potentially long-standing infestation that requires immediate professional attention to prevent further deterioration and costly repairs.

Night Noises

Hearing scratching, scurrying, or gnawing noises in your walls, ceilings, or attic, especially at night, strongly suggests rodent activity. A faint clicking or rustling sound within walls can sometimes be indicative of active termites, particularly drywoods. Disturbance in your walls when no one is around should prompt an investigation.
